Tame Bridge Parkway boasts a ticket office with generous opening hours, from 6:00 AM to 7:00 PM on weekdays and Saturdays, and from 10:00 AM to 4:00 PM on Sundays. Whether you're planning ahead or making a spontaneous trip, you'll find ticket machines available for purchases and collections—even those bought online. Accessibility is a priority, with induction loops and accessible ticket machines provided for ease of use.
While the station does not offer luggage storage, lost property, or enhanced waiting rooms, rest assured there is CCTV coverage for added security. The seating area ensures travelers can rest comfortably while awaiting their train. For those requiring assistance, staff are available during ticket office hours, and help points are distributed throughout the station.
Travelers will appreciate the station's accessibility features, such as step-free access to all platforms. However, note that some routes might include long or steep ramps, and accessible toilets are not available. The station car park, operated by Transport for West Midlands, is open 24/7 and offers 231 spaces, including 14 accessible ones—all free of charge.
While Tame Bridge Parkway does not have refreshment or shopping facilities on site, the station makes up for it with strong transport links to satisfy your plans. With bicycle storage available, including stands and lockers near the ticket office, Tame Bridge makes a perfect stop for cyclists.
If you're planning onward journeys, Tame Bridge Parkway offers various transport connections. Rail replacement services operate from Walsall Road, right outside the station, ensuring continued travel in the event of train service interruptions. If you need a taxi, local services like Junction Taxi and Dolphins can be reached easily at the station. Additionally, downloadable bus service information is available to facilitate your continued journey.

Ashtead Station, managed by Southern, offers a variety of amenities to cater to travelers' diverse needs. The ticket office operates from early morning to late at night, ensuring you can purchase tickets and seek assistance throughout much of the day. Ticket machines, accessible to all, are fitted to accommodate Disabled Persons Railcard discounts, although you might want to verify accessibility across the station first.
Passenger support is a priority with help points and staff available most of the day. While luggage storage options are not available, there's plenty of seating, and for those keen on staying connected, pay phones are provided.
At Ashtead Station, accessibility is thoughtfully integrated. While the station offers partial step-free access through level crossings, it’s advisable to pre-book assistance or reach out for help upon your arrival. The station staff are trained and willing to assist, including using ramps for boarding trains. Despite the absence of accessible toilets, there are accessible ticket machines and a designated drop-off and pick-up point for travelers with impaired mobility.
Connectivity options surround Ashtead Station, making onward travel a breeze. Although direct bus links from the station itself aren't highlighted, local bus services can be found nearby. For those needing it, more information on replacement bus services is readily available online.

However you choose to journey, Ashtead caters with ample car parking operated by APCOA Parking UK, open 24 hours, offering 240 spaces including 12 dedicated to accessible parking. Cyclists are also accommodated with storage stands located safely within the station’s car park.
